On the carburetor hold the throttle lever to where it would be at full throttle. Then you can put the cable back in the catch for the cable that is on the throttle lever and let go of the throttle lever. The throttle cable should work with the throttle trigger now. The throttle cable only fits one way. The larger hole on the throttle cable catch should go to the ball at the end of the cable.
I hope this helps.
